:root{--bg-primary: #12100e;--bg-secondary: #1f1917;--surface: rgba(36, 31, 28, .86);--surface-strong: rgba(20, 17, 15, .94);--text-primary: #f5f0e8;--text-secondary: #9e9487;--accent-gold: #ebb856;--accent-amber: #f59438;--accent-warm: #e0a547;--battery-red: #e04738;--battery-green: #6bcb61;--border-soft: rgba(255, 255, 255, .1);--shadow-soft: 0 20px 50px rgba(0, 0, 0, .35);--radius-lg: 1.25rem;--radius-md: 1rem;--max-width: 1120px}*{box-sizing:border-box}html,body{margin:0;padding:0}html{scroll-behavior:smooth}body{font-family:SF Pro Display,SF Pro Text,Avenir Next,Segoe UI,sans-serif;background:linear-gradient(180deg,#1f1917,#12100e 35%,#0f0d0c);color:var(--text-primary);min-height:100vh;line-height:1.55}main{position:relative;z-index:1}.page-bg{position:fixed;inset:0;z-index:0;pointer-events:none;background:radial-gradient(45rem 28rem at 10% 0%,rgba(245,148,56,.16) 0%,transparent 60%),radial-gradient(38rem 24rem at 95% 20%,rgba(235,184,86,.12) 0%,transparent 68%),radial-gradient(32rem 24rem at 65% 80%,rgba(224,165,71,.09) 0%,transparent 72%)}img,picture{max-width:100%;display:block}a{color:inherit}a:hover{color:var(--text-primary)}a:focus-visible,button:focus-visible{outline:2px solid var(--accent-gold);outline-offset:2px}h1,h2,h3,h4,p{margin:0}h1,h2,h3{text-wrap:balance}h1{font-size:clamp(2rem,5vw,3.45rem);line-height:1.1;letter-spacing:-.02em}h2{font-size:clamp(1.6rem,3vw,2.45rem);line-height:1.15;letter-spacing:-.01em}h3{font-size:1.08rem}p{color:var(--text-secondary)}.container{width:min(var(--max-width),calc(100% - 2rem));margin-inline:auto}.section{padding:clamp(3.75rem,10vw,7rem) 0}.eyebrow{color:var(--accent-gold);font-size:.8rem;letter-spacing:.13em;text-transform:uppercase;font-weight:600;margin-bottom:.9rem}.btn{display:inline-flex;align-items:center;justify-content:center;border-radius:999px;text-decoration:none;font-weight:600;transition:transform .2s ease,box-shadow .2s ease,border-color .2s ease}.btn:hover{transform:translateY(-1px)}.btn-primary{background:linear-gradient(130deg,var(--accent-gold),var(--accent-amber));color:#1a130d;box-shadow:0 12px 30px #f594383d;padding:.85rem 1.3rem}.btn-ghost{border:1px solid var(--border-soft);padding:.85rem 1.25rem;color:var(--text-primary);background:#ffffff05}.btn-small{padding:.56rem .95rem;font-size:.92rem}.skip-link{position:absolute;left:-9999px;top:0;background:var(--text-primary);color:#111;padding:.45rem .7rem;z-index:200}.skip-link:focus{left:.75rem;top:.75rem}.site-header{position:sticky;top:0;z-index:50;backdrop-filter:blur(10px);background:#12100eb3;border-bottom:1px solid rgba(255,255,255,.05)}.nav-wrap{min-height:4.4rem;display:flex;align-items:center;justify-content:space-between;gap:.9rem}.brand{display:inline-flex;align-items:center;gap:.72rem;text-decoration:none;font-weight:700;letter-spacing:.01em;line-height:1}.brand-mark{width:2rem;height:2rem;border-radius:.5rem;object-fit:cover;display:block;flex-shrink:0;box-shadow:0 8px 20px #00000061}.nav-links{margin:0;padding:0;list-style:none;display:inline-flex;align-items:center;gap:1rem}.nav-links a{text-decoration:none;color:var(--text-secondary);font-size:.95rem}.nav-links a.active,.nav-links a:hover{color:var(--text-primary)}.hero{padding-top:clamp(4rem,8vw,6.5rem)}.hero-grid{display:grid;align-items:center;gap:2.2rem;grid-template-columns:1.08fr .92fr}.hero-copy{max-width:38rem}.hero-subtitle{margin-top:1rem;font-size:clamp(1rem,2vw,1.12rem)}.hero-actions{display:flex;gap:.75rem;margin-top:1.4rem;flex-wrap:wrap}.hero-footnote{margin-top:1rem;font-size:.9rem}.hero-device{display:flex;justify-content:center}.hero-stack{position:relative;width:min(30rem,100%);min-height:31rem}.hero-shot{position:absolute;margin:0;border-radius:1.9rem;padding:.5rem;border:1px solid rgba(255,255,255,.2);background:linear-gradient(160deg,#ffffff14,#12100e99);box-shadow:var(--shadow-soft)}.hero-shot img{border-radius:1.4rem;width:100%;height:auto}.hero-shot-main{width:58%;left:21%;top:2%;z-index:3}.hero-shot-two{width:40%;left:0;top:30%;transform:rotate(-8deg);z-index:2}.hero-shot-three{width:41%;right:0;top:26%;transform:rotate(8deg);z-index:1}.feature-card,.step-card,.trust-card,.download-card,.legal-content,.legal-note{background:var(--surface);border:1px solid var(--border-soft);border-radius:var(--radius-lg);box-shadow:0 8px 26px #0003}.label{font-size:.76rem;letter-spacing:.06em;color:var(--text-secondary);text-transform:uppercase}.feature-grid,.trust-grid{margin-top:1.4rem;display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:.95rem}.feature-card,.trust-card{padding:1.05rem}.feature-card p,.step-card p,.trust-card p{margin-top:.6rem}.steps-grid{margin:1.4rem 0 0;padding:0;list-style:none;display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:.95rem}.step-card{padding:1.05rem}.step-index{display:inline-flex;align-items:center;justify-content:center;width:2rem;height:2rem;margin-bottom:.8rem;border-radius:50%;background:linear-gradient(160deg,#ebb85638,#f5943829);color:var(--accent-gold);font-size:.83rem;font-weight:700}.section-intro{margin-top:.9rem;max-width:45rem}.download-card{padding:clamp(1.4rem,2vw,2rem);text-align:center;background:radial-gradient(40rem 12rem at 50% 0%,rgba(235,184,86,.13),transparent 60%),var(--surface-strong)}.download-card p{margin:.95rem auto 0;max-width:40rem}.download-card .btn{margin-top:1.2rem}.site-footer{border-top:1px solid rgba(255,255,255,.08);background:#100e0dcc;position:relative;z-index:1}.footer-content{display:flex;justify-content:space-between;gap:1rem;padding:2rem 0 1rem;flex-wrap:wrap}.footer-title{display:inline-flex;align-items:center;gap:.62rem;color:var(--text-primary);font-weight:700;line-height:1}.footer-icon{width:1.7rem;height:1.7rem;border-radius:.45rem;object-fit:cover;display:block;flex-shrink:0}.footer-line{margin-top:.45rem;max-width:34rem}.footer-links{display:flex;flex-wrap:wrap;gap:.9rem 1rem}.footer-links a{color:var(--text-secondary);text-decoration:none}.footer-links span{color:var(--text-secondary)}.footer-links a:hover{color:var(--text-primary)}.footer-meta{padding-bottom:2rem}.footer-meta p{font-size:.9rem}.legal-section{padding-top:clamp(2.5rem,6vw,4rem)}.legal-wrap{max-width:52rem}.legal-meta{margin-top:.6rem}.legal-note{margin-top:1rem;padding:.95rem 1rem}.legal-content{margin-top:1.2rem;padding:1.2rem}.legal-content h2{font-size:1.25rem;margin-top:1.3rem}.legal-content h2:first-child{margin-top:0}.legal-content p,.legal-content ul{margin-top:.7rem}.legal-content ul{padding-left:1.2rem;color:var(--text-secondary)}.shimmer-text{color:#f3e8d6;background-image:repeating-linear-gradient(90deg,#bfb2a0,#f0c972,#fff2bf,#f0c972 168px,#bfb2a0 224px 280px);background-size:280px 100%;background-position:0 0;line-height:1.22;padding-bottom:.09em;overflow:visible;-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;will-change:background-position;animation:shimmer-sweep 5.4s linear infinite}@keyframes shimmer-sweep{0%{background-position:0 0}to{background-position:280px 0}}@media(prefers-reduced-motion:reduce){.shimmer-text{animation:none;background-position:0 0}}@media(max-width:1024px){.hero-grid{grid-template-columns:1fr}.hero-device{justify-content:center}.hero-stack{min-height:29rem;width:min(28rem,100%)}.feature-grid,.steps-grid,.trust-grid{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(max-width:760px){.site-header{position:static}.nav-wrap{flex-wrap:wrap;padding:.8rem 0}.nav-links{width:100%;order:3;justify-content:space-between}.btn-small{margin-left:auto}.hero-device{justify-content:center}.hero-stack{min-height:25rem;width:min(23rem,100%)}.feature-grid,.steps-grid,.trust-grid{grid-template-columns:1fr}}
